This past week I finished the first draft of my new play in THE HOLLYWOOD LEGENDS series. It's the first one I've written since the mid-1990s.
The last several pages "wrote themselves" a lot quicker than I expected. I've even done some polishing since then, and the manuscript is now in the hands of a trusted friend and professional for her input.
Unlike my other plays in this series, the new one is a TWO-Person play, rather than a monologue. It even has music.
However, unlike JOLSON and CHEVALIER, all of the songs I'm using are in the public domain. Copyright holders, for the most part, have been very nice to me on those older shows, but I really don't want to deal with music licensing any longer. It's too time consuming and complicated. Thus, public domain.
The title of the new play is NELSON AND JEANETTE.
And, with that information, if you can't guess the identities of the subjects, then you're probably not going to read it anyway.
:-)
In any event, I had fun writing it. Assuming that my friend's notes don't trigger a major rewrite, I'll probably make the script available in both paperback and on Kindle within the next month or two.
